Calibra Invest estimates rising business in 2008

Tourism agency Calibra Invest in Cluj-Napoca (central-west) estimates a tuirnover worth some 9.5 million euros for this year, up 26 percent as against 2007.
 
Martin Bikfalvi, the agency’s general manager aims to reach the predicted turnover by attracting customers through programmes with new destinations, by increasing the number of charter flights on traditional routes and opening a branch in Egypt.
 
Calibra reported 7.5 million euros in turnover in 2007, up 12 percent as against the level of 2006 and a profit of some 450,000 euros, up 23 percent compared to 2006.
 
According to Bikfalvi, at present, the outgoing segment holds a share of 80 percent in the company’s turnover and the business travel – 10 percent.
 
Also in 2008, the company will have a 4-star hotel following an investment worth 2 million euros.
Bikfalvi estimates the Romanian tourism market will go up 20-26 percent in 2008.
 
Some of Calibra Travel’s competitors are Happy Tour, Eximtur, Marshal Turism, Aerotravel or J’Info Tours. The biggest travel agencies operating in Romania reported revenues worth 600 million euros.
